Decision
ORDERED that the Executive:
- Note the report of the Place Scrutiny Panel into Barriers to Regeneration and its accompanying recommendations; and
- Approve the Action Plan prepared by the service in response to those recommendations.

Alternative options considered
OPTIONS
Executive considered the option of taking no action. This was not supported, as the Panel’s recommendations provided a clear and deliverable direction for the service and represented an opportunity to address identified barriers to regeneration.
Executive also considered the option of delivering all recommendations in full. This was not supported, as some proposals would be difficult to deliver or offer limited benefit, and therefore each recommendation had been individually assessed and incorporated into the Action Plan where appropriate.
